Re: How to add files from drop box to the Bard mobile app? I understand that if you have books on your computer, you can add them to the Bard mobile app using dropbox.

2013-09-21 Thread Mary Otten
Put the book into dropbox on your computer. Open dropbox on your iPhone. Hit export. Find the Bard app in the list of apps that you can use to export a file. Double tap it and visit file should go into the Bard app. This is according to the hints and tips near the end of the Bard help document.
